Abstract

Purpose – Today, Muslims face considerable challenges in the era of the industrial revolution. On the one hand, there is the threat of liberalization that erodes spiritual values and Islamic teachings fundamentally. On the other hand, there is radicalization that uses violence in the name of religion, such as threats, terror, disbelief, and murder. They are serious problems that require efforts to understand the linkage between intolerant behavior and religious teachings. Design/methods/approach – This study is library research conducted through the steps of recording, clarifying, reducing, and presenting data using documentation methods from primary and secondary sources. The data analyzed by the content analysis method includes the meaning of wasathiyah Islam, religious moderation, the concept of wasathiyah Islam in the Qur'an, Surat Al-Baqarah verse 143, and moderation-based Islamic education. Findings – This research found that religious moderation can be applied to Islamic Education subjects through various approaches. Subjects such as Aqidah, Akhlaq, Fiqh, Tarikh, and Al-Qur'an Hadith integrate the wasathiyah values by emphasizing tolerance, dialogue, justice, and benefit from an Islamic perspective. Learning approaches, like problem-solving, inquiry, and discussion, have encouraged students to think multiperspective, discover new knowledge, and respect the ideas of others, both inside and outside of school. Research implications/limitations – This research provides important implications for the development of Islamic education based on religious moderation, especially through a curriculum that can integrate the values of tolerance, justice, and balance in learning. However, it is still limited to a literature approach, so further research is required with an empirical approach to measure the effectiveness of applying these values in various educational contexts. Originality/value – This research offers a unique perspective by using the concept of wasathiyah Islam to support Islamic education based on religious moderation. The novelty value lies in the elaboration of the implementation of moderation in various subjects, such as Aqidah, Akhlaq, Fiqh, Tarikh, and Al-Qur'an Hadith, which can be a model for the development of inclusive and tolerant education.
